Celebrating our 20th anniversary in 2024, H2Safety Services Inc. is the largest Emergency Response Management provider in Canada.

Equipped with decades of experience, our team of industry leading experts deliver comprehensive, tailored Emergency Management, Health, Safety, and Environment (HSE), Emergency Response Training, and Technology services to companies throughout Canada, North America, and around the world.

By continually investing in our people and world-class technology, we ensure the highest level of protection and compliance for our clients, stakeholders, and the environment.

We are currently seeking a Process & Quality Assurance Specialist to support our VP, Process & Quality Assurance in elevating our company's quality standards, ensuring regulatory compliance and fostering a culture of continuous improvement.

The Process & Quality Assurance Specialist will collaborate cross-departmentally, ensuring that across the board, the organization is delivering high quality products and services that meet or exceed customer expectations.


What You'll Do & How You'll Make an Impact

Quality Management System (QMS):

  • In partnership with various departments, assist with the development of a formalized Quality Management System (QMS) to ensure seamless integration of quality assurance processes throughout the organization.

Process and Quality Assurance:

  • Develop and implement quality assurance processes, procedures and documentation to ensure compliance with industry standards and regulatory requirements.
  • Keep informed about industry standards and regulations. Update processes to comply with any changes and ensure understanding among relevant parties.
  • Collaborate with various departments to identify and implement process improvements, providing regular feedback and enhancing overall quality and efficiency.
  • Help establish, document, and communicate departmental quality standards, ensuring alignment with needs of department and overall company objectives.

Reviews & Audits:

  • Develop review and audit documentation for assessing Emergency Response Plan (ERP) quality and for other critical projects before delivery to clients.
  • Conduct regular audits and inspections of ERP components to assess compliance with quality standards, regulatory requirements, and client expectations.

Tracking & Reporting:

  • Analyze quality data to identify trends, patterns, or recurring issues and provide crossfunctional teams with actionable insights for continuous improvement.
  • Conduct and monitor feedback from both internal and external stakeholders to gauge client satisfaction and process effectiveness.

Documentation:

  • Maintain detailed quality assurance records to track product and service processes, identify root causes, and share lessons learned for internal process improvement.

Training:

  • Provide training and support to employees on quality assurance processes, procedures, and best practices.
  • In collaboration with leadership, foster a culture of quality across all levels of the organization.

Problem Resolution:

  • Investigate and document all qualityrelated concerns or trends, and collaborate with crossfunctional teams to implement solutions.
